They were there to raise a bottle of craft beer to the
launch of the Dutch capital’s first ‘barcade’, a hipsterish
concept borrowed, inevitably, from Brooklyn by Serdar
Tonkas, the Ton Ton Club’s 31-year old co-founder. But,
while the beautiful, retro arcade interior of his new
venture, stuffed with iconic 1980s and 90s game
machines, such as
Mortal Kombat
and
Daytona USA
,
would not look out of place in New York’s coolest
borough, the setting just might.
